The math account is a username and password that is used to access the math department computing resources.
 
==== Why not just use NetIDs? ====
 
The old system existed long before NetIDs, and there are many people who are still using their pre-NetID accounts for regular work. Also, there are many rules and constraints to connecting math department machines to the central Cornell system.

==== Math Account Resources ====
 
* A consistent desktop environment across all systems, from desktop workstations, to large number crunchers, to pay-as-you-go systems at the Center for Advanced Computing, or Amazon AWS.
* A personal file storage area that is backed up regularly, in your home directory.
* Access to a very large, fast volume for larger datasets, in the <code>/space</code> volume.
* Access to very fast local storage on all of the machines, in <code>/local</code>
* Commercial software such as Matlab, Mathematica, Maple, Magma, and many others, already configured for GPU and cluster access.
* Major free software titles, configured and ready to use, with GPU or cluster support as applicable. These include GAP, pari/gp, Macaulay2, Sage, Python, R, Julia, and many more.
* In-browser access to the Linux desktop environment where all of these tools are available.
 
==== Getting a Math Account ====
 
Anyone at Math who is a member of the math.instructors group may send an invite to a NetID to set up a Math account, by going to https://accounts.math.cornell.edu/ and clicking the 'invite user' link.
Anyone with a NetID may have a math account, all we ask is that they're respectful of system resources (details below).
 
==== Resource Usage ====
 
Commercial software such as Matlab, Mathematica, and Maple have a limited number of licenses. This means there can only be a certain number of these programs running at any given time in the department (including Math machines running in the cloud). Please don't leave these programs running when they're not in use, since you'll be taking up a license. Priority for these programs is for Math faculty, grad students, and researchers. Right now there is no restriction on who can run these programs, but if people have trouble getting an available license, access may be restricted to certain groups.
 
Files in your home account, under <code>/homes/{username}</code> are backed up every 24 hours. Please be aware of how much space you are using. A few gigabytes is fine, but large data will fill up our backups. Use the <code>/space</code> volume for that. We don't strictly enforce file quotas, but if there is a problem with accounts filling up, we may have to.
 
The <code>/space</code> volume is large and fast. You may put large amounts of data into <code>/space</code>, all we ask is that you are a 'good neighbor' and don't abuse the privilege. Files in the <code>/space</code> volume can be read at 10GB/second by the calculation machines. <code>/space</code> is not officially backed up, but we usually make snapshots nightly, just in case. This backup is not guaranteed to happen the way it is for your home account. To use the <code>/space</code> volume, make a directory there whose name is the same as your username. Then you may put whatever you want inside that directory.
 
Each machine has a <code>/local</code> volume. Some are larger than others. They are all VERY fast because they're on the local machine. Remember, the contents of <code>/local</code> will be different on every machine. Just like on <code>/space</code>, you may create a directory with the same name as your username, then put whatever you want inside there. Please be careful not to fill up the volume, use the '<code>df'</code> command to check the percentage of space used.
 
=== Connecting to your Math account ===
 
Connecting is very easy these days. Due to increased security requirements from Cornell, we have a [https://portal.math.cornell.edu/ portal] where all of our in-browser resources are available behind a single Cornell NetID login.
 
Once logged in, you have a menu with access to various resources. This resource menu will change as it's improved and new services are added.
 
* '''Web Desktop''' lets you connect to a Math department Linux desktop, inside your browser, without any additional software or VPN.
* '''JupyterHub''' lets you log in to a Jupyter Notebook on any of the systems. You can also open a terminal and transfer files.
* '''Webdisk''' lets you transfer files and do some other operations. It's older and you can do all of this with JupyterHub, but some people still like it.
* '''System Status''' (graphs) lets you see system resource usage in real-time (once a minute) so you can see which systems are busy and what's going on with your jobs.
* '''Wiki''' is a link to this wiki site. You may edit or add pages! Just click 'Log In' and your NetID should appear in the upper right.
* '''Account Settings''' takes you to the 'accounts' page, where you can reset your password, or if you're an instructor, you can invite users and manage your groups.
* '''Print Portal''' allows printing from any network or device, with a login. You must be in the math.dept group to use this. Upload a PDF and print it, from any phone, tablet, or computer. Please only use this when physically present at Malott hall!
 
These services use your Math username and password. If you're prompted for a password, that's the one to use.
 
Some of these use your NetID, such as wiki, graphs, or print portal. Since you're already logged in with your NetID, you should not be prompted when you use these services.
 
Account Settings will always prompt you again for a NetID login, for security reasons.
 
=== Other Connections ===
 
You can also connect in more traditional ways, using the Cornell VPN. You can use SSH, SFTP, and other desktop software such as X2GO or Remote Desktop Connection.
